Proto-Inupik: *palaʁ-
Eskimo etymology: Eskimo etymology
Meaning: not to get or give enough 1, to wrestle a bit, to defeat effortlessly 2, loose (no longer held back) 3
Russian meaning: давать или получать недостаточно 1, поразить без усилий, не боровшись 2, расслабленный 3
Seward Peninsula Inupik: palaq- 1
SPI Dialects: Imaq paláʁaɣa 1, paláqtumāroq 'suffering'
North Alaskan Inupik: palaq- 1
NAI Dialects: Nu palaq- 2
WCI Dialects: Sig palaq- 1, Net palait- (neg.) 'to be greedy'
Eastern Canadian Inupik: palaq- 'to work badly', palaŋa- 3
Greenlandic Inupik: palaŋŋaʁ- 'to loosen (rheum)'
Comparative Eskimo Dictionary: 248
